-
Автор темы
- #1
Высокий пинг (слишком долгое время отправки пакета) очень нервирует игроков всех онлайн-игр, требующих скорости реакции, особенно это касается Counter-Strike 1.6, ведь даже когда игрок проявляет максимум ловкости и концентрации внимания, проблемы со скоростью отправки и получения пакетов приводят к поражению.
Следовательно чем ниже пинг, тем комфортнее и достовернее игровой процесс. Проверить пинг в CS 1.6 можно при помощи нажатия клавиши "Tab".
Зависимость пинга прямо пропорциональна расстоянию до сервера (если дальше от вас сервер, значит выше пинг), кроме того его повышает загруженность вашего канала Интернета (именно по этому во время игры нужно закрывать всё ПО, потребляющее трафик).
Чтобы увидеть статистику соединения в консоли введите команду net_graph 3, она отобразиться справа в нижнем углу и будет содержать информацию о входящих и исходящих соединениях, актуальный пинг, кадровую частоту и количество потерянных при приеме-передаче пакетов.
Показатель "Loss" отображает число, информирующее, сколько пакетов было утрачено при передаче от сервера. Если оно высокое значит объем информации который сервер пытается передать не может пройти сквозь канал и его следует уменьшить.
Показатель "Choke" — показатель того, какое количество пакетов ваш ПК не в состоянии передать серверу так как скорость вашего соединения или потому, что сервер запрашивает излишне много информации.
Что же можно изменить, чтобы понизить пинг в cs 1.6?
cl_updaterate позволит скорректировать число обновлений в секунду, которые посылает сервер для компьютера (регулировка loss) уменьшите ешго если у вас присутствует loss, а если loss нет то увеличение поможет снизить пинг. Оптимальные значения: модему - 15-25; выделенной линии - 50-10, а для локалки - 100.
cl_cmdrate — позволит скорректировать число обновлений в секунду отправляемых от вашего ПК к серверу (регулировка choke). Если choke есть его следует снизить, если нет, его повышение может уменьшить пинг. Оптимальные значения: модему - 25-35, для выделенки - 60-100, локалка - 100.
Показатель "rate" — отображает скорость обмена пакетами между сервером и ПК. Именно неверная установка этого параметра может повлечь появление loss или choke.
Этот показатель нужно согласовать со скоростью собственного соединения. а после со значением sv_maxrate для сервера. Этот параметр не должен превышать скорость вашего соединения. Уменьшать rate нужно при наличии choke и loss в одночасье, если нет, пробуйте его увеличить до показателей: модем (56 кбит/сек) - 3500-5000; выделенка (DSL) - 7500; высокоскоростные каналы и локалки: 9999 или 25000
Умолчания этих значений в игре: cl_updaterate 20; cl_cmdrate 30; rate 7500. Макси параметры консольных команд, которые использует большинство игроков по локалке, чтобы понизить пинг в cs 1.6: cl_updaterate 100; cl_cmdrate 100; rate 25000.
Если у вас немощный ПК, то запускайте игру используя низкий приоритет, производительность игры повыситься, а пинг уменьшиться
[video=youtube;L8MxIx5CZ-w]http://www.youtube.com/watch?v=L8MxIx5CZ-w[/video]